Costain have a unique opportunity for a passional Senior Construction Manager to join West Winch Housing Access Road (WWHAR) for Norfolk County Council (NCC).
Costain has been appointed to design and construct the West Winch Housing Access Road (WWHAR) for Norfolk County Council (NCC). The project is in 3 stages
- Stage 1 will involve detailed design, early contractor involvement (ECI) and on-site investigations, including gaining approvals from stakeholders
- Stage 2 will be to construct and handover the works into operations
- Stage 3 will be to maintain the environmental mitigation and biodiversity nett gain planting
The new housing access road will connect the A10 to the A47 to the west of West Winch. Works will include
- 2.5km of new single carriageway associated active travel routes and roundabouts forming access to new developments and onto the A10.
- A new structure over the housing access road and modification of an existing structure on the A47
- Management of groundwater to enable installation of the drainage
- Management of utility works
- Modifications to the existing A10 improve active travel
Working directly under the Project Director as part of the Senior Management Team, this role is to lead construction operations to ensure all elements are delivered safely, to the required quality, on time and within budget, all in line with the scheme design and associated highway specifications and in compliance with the specification and scope including planning constraints. This will include managing a team of engineering staff and subcontractors, working alongside the site supervisory team and other disciplines (SHE, Stakeholder, Design/Engineering/Quality, Commercial etc.). Applicants with local authority and Strategic Road Network experience are preferred.
Working closely with the Engineering Manager, in stage 1, you will lead on site investigation and the ECI team to ensure design is safe and efficient to construct. In stage 2 you will also ensure the permanent works product and corresponding documentation meets the standards required to hand over the assets into operation to both NCC and NH.
Responsibilities
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Ensure construction is adequately considered in detailed design
- Provide construction leadership and manage all aspects of construction including investigations/surveys and mobilisation.
- Ensure all works are carried out in accordance with The Costain Way.
- Put safety above all else and lead by example.
- Promote a Safe, Efficient, Right First-Time approach to quality and avoid rework.
- Manage a team of engineering staff and collaborate with other members of the project leadership team.
- Support the Project Director in all construction matters including handover.
- Provide planning and procurement support, implementing product control and all related subcontract activities.
Knowledge, Skills, and Experience
- Extensive experience in construction delivery with note worthy time spent in a management position (e.g. Agent/Senior Agent)
- Knowledge and experience of relevant design solutions and standards (Specification for Highways Works), common highways construction techniques and related procedures
- Experience of working within a Principal Designer and Principal Contractor environment (i.e. where Costain undertakes these roles)
- Knowledge and experience of Temporary Works procedures
- Ability to deliver high quality construction and associated documentation to enable handover
- Understanding of National Highways’ handover processes
- Local authority and SRN environment design/construction experience
- Experience of gaining and discharging consents from Statutory Environmental Bodies
- Experience of gaining design approvals from relevant authorities
QUALIFICATIONS
- Degree or HND in Civil Engineering or allied subject or equivalent vocational training
- Relevant CSCS Card
- SMSTS or equivalent H&S qualification
- Chartered Engineer and Membership of a professional engineering institution
- Temporary works coordinator and/or lifting AP
